Friedrich Air Conditioning Co. has announced its latest developments in portable units, ductless systems and room air conditioning units.
Increasing Use of Portables
For building owners looking for spot A/C solutions, Friedrich has re-designed its single-hose ZoneAire Compact portable unit.
This three-in-one 115 volt unit serves as an air conditioner, a dehumidifier and a heater. Friedrich ZoneAire Compact features a LED display, rotary dial four-speed fan and temperature adjustment controls, along with a hose attachment. The Friedrich ZoneAire Compact line has been expanded to include a 12,000 Btu (6,888 under SACC criteria) unit. This model also offers bonus heat performance capabilities with 12,300 Btu (7,100 under SACC criteria).
At 17-inches wide, the Friedrich ZoneAire Compact has swivel casters and built-in hose storage compartment, making it an option for personal cooling or heating on the go.
Ductless Demand
Ductless systems have become popular in the U.S. thanks to its quiet operation, energy efficiency and application options without the need for ductwork. The industry is responding to a rise in ductless demand by offering more options along with professional installation. As awareness of this category grows, Friedrich continues to expand its line-up of ductless solutions to provide year-round heating and cooling.
Its two lines of ductless systems are based on SEER efficiency. The mid-tier Floating Air Series comes in five models, with 115 volt and 230/208 volt heat pump units. The top-tier line from Friedrich is the J Series, which is available in more than 1,000 multizone configurations, including wall-mounted, ceiling cassette and concealed duct models. Customers can choose from single-zone cooling models, single-zone heat pumps that cool and heat, and multi-zone heat pumps that cool and heat multiple rooms.
This year Friedrich introduced ENERGY STAR qualified 9,000 and 12,000 Btu models, capable of delivering up to 28 SEER/12.5 HSPF, with ambient heat pump operation down to -13 F, as part of the company’s J-Series ductless product line.
A/C Solutions
Friedrich room air conditioning units, including its Kühl line, have been a smart solution for several years. Kühl offers options, ranging from 6,000 to 36,000 Btu in cooling-only, electric heating and cooling and heat pump models.
New for the Kühl line in 2018, Friedrich plans to introduce its updated FriedrichLink Wi-Fi. This cloud-based digital solution features simplified user experience, streamlining remote management. The Wi-Fi capabilities allows for programming with the ability to connect multiple units, as well as demand response and energy management capabilities, via connected devices.
